New Article on digital discovery

"General data management workflow to process tabular data in automated and high-throughput heterogeneous catalysis research"  

We are pleased to present our latest work on open research data (ORD). This work describes a Python library developed at ETHZ SwissCAT+ as part of its data management strategy. Output data from various high-throughput/automated equipment such as Chemspeed, Unchained Labs and Avantium are merged and processed to be further used in AI-driven closed loop optimization workflows using Atinary Technologies's SDLabs platform. The presented Python library enables transparent tracing on how data are processed and normalized to foster effective utilization of open research data.
